Facebook facelift

OooOOOooooh! Facebook got a facelift!! There's a new swanky version kicking around and it actually gives users a bit more control over what they do and don't want to see. You get to set preferences for the type of news stories / people you're interested in and it looks familiar enough to be instantly usable, and it's much easier to comment on little bits which interest you, rather than having to wade around finding points at which to make comment (that last bit'll make sense if you take a look at 'new' Facebook).

Easier to publish stuff, easier to read stuff, easier to customize it... looks good on first glance. Just gotta block those annoying ads on the right hand side... and I'm sorted. :o)

Now then... when's this sort of flexibility going to built into institutional VLEs... hmmm?
